gitlab安裝教程
阿新 • • 發佈:2017-06-09
ont about con ica url localhost install cmd nts
gitlab安裝教程
安裝教程
官網安裝方法
https://about.gitlab.com/downloads/#centos7
1.準備
sudo yum install curl policycoreutils openssh-server openssh-clients sudo systemctl enable sshd sudo systemctl start sshd sudo yum install postfix sudo systemctl enable postfix sudo systemctl start postfix sudo firewall-cmd --permanent --add-service=http sudo systemctl reload firewalld
2.下載並且安裝
curl -sS https://packages.gitlab.com/install/repositories/gitlab/gitlab-ce/script.rpm.sh | sudo bash sudo yum install gitlab-ce
3.啟動服務
sudo gitlab-ctl reconfigure
4.訪問界面
curl loalhost 如果有返回登錄說明已經配置好。也可以使用瀏覽器輸入localhost,前提端口別沖突。
5.配置企業郵箱
企業郵箱配置和個人郵箱配置不同,這裏直接介紹企業郵箱配置
vi /etc/gitlab/gitlab.rb
插入下面內容
gitlab_rails[‘smtp_enable‘] = true
gitlab_rails[‘smtp_address‘] = "smtp.exmail.qq.com"
gitlab_rails[‘smtp_port‘] = 465
gitlab_rails[‘smtp_user_name‘] = "[email protected]"
gitlab_rails[‘smtp_password‘] = "88888888"
gitlab_rails[‘smtp_domain‘] = "kongming.ren"
gitlab_rails[‘smtp_authentication‘] = "login"
gitlab_rails[‘smtp_enable_starttls_auto‘] = true
gitlab_rails[‘smtp_tls‘] = true
gitlab_rails[‘gitlab_email_from‘] = " [email protected] "
保存完後運行 sudo gitlab-ctl reconfigure
Complete!
gitlab安裝教程